How often should I get my Toyota Corolla serviced?

I just bought a used Toyota Corolla and I want to make sure I properly maintain it. What is the recommended service schedule and where is the best place to get it serviced? I don't want to spend unnecessary money but also want to make sure my car is running smoothly and efficiently.

It is recommended to get your Toyota Corolla serviced every 5,000 miles or 6 months, whichever comes first. As for where to get it serviced, it's best to stick with a reputable dealership or a certified mechanic who specializes in Toyota vehicles. They will have the knowledge and experience to properly service your car without overcharging you.

If you're comfortable with doing basic maintenance on your own, you can save some money by learning how to do simple tasks like oil changes and tire rotations yourself. Just make sure to follow your car's manual and use quality products for the best results.

It's important to keep up with regular maintenance on your car to prevent bigger and more costly issues down the road. Plus, a well-maintained car will have better resale value. So even though it may seem like an added expense now, it'll save you money in the long run.
